STEM building, Ardingly College

Ardingly College is an independent school, with co-educational boarding and day pupils set in West Sussex in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.

The College approached vHH in 2015 with the aim to replace and provide new fit for purpose science laboratories to suit modern curricular needs. In addition, the College aims to provide new Design and Technology workshops equipped with modern machinery and tools that is integrated with the Science building to enhance cross curriculum needs of STEM.

The new facilities we have designed actively integrate with the existing buildings, to create a single Science and Technology department. The double height circulation atrium links the extension to the existing building and provides a unique break out space for STEM displays and student work, while brand news labs are encased by large windows which look out over the surrounding countryside.
